Effective SEO Strategies for Physician Websites in 2024

Physicians who manage their own websites face a unique challenge in balancing their professional responsibilities with the need to maintain a strong online presence.

Implementing effective Search Engine Optimization (SEO) strategies can greatly enhance website visibility, attracting more patients and establishing authority in their field.

Here are several SEO tips tailored specifically for physicians looking to optimize their websites:

1. Splinter Content for Specific Medical Queries

Physicians often cover broad topics on their websites. By splintering this content into more focused, specific pages, you can target particular medical conditions or treatments more effectively. For example, if a general page on cardiovascular health ranks modestly for several related keywords, creating dedicated pages for heart disease, hypertension, and cholesterol management can improve rankings. Each focused page should link back to the main topic, forming a structured content network.

2. Experience-Driven Content

Google’s E-A-T guidelines (Expertise, Authoritativeness, Trustworthiness) emphasize the value of content created from direct experience. Physicians have a unique advantage here, as their daily professional activities provide a wealth of firsthand knowledge that can be shared. Whether it’s detailed case studies, patient management strategies, or insights into medical procedures, authentic content directly from your clinical experiences will resonate more with your audience and be favored by search engines.

3. Optimize Existing Content

Review your existing content and identify pages that rank between positions 2 and 15 for targeted keywords. These pages are prime candidates for optimization. Look for opportunities to update them with the latest medical data, incorporate more detailed patient care strategies, or address recent advances in your field. This approach not only helps improve rankings but also ensures your content remains relevant and valuable to your audience.

4. Curate External Expertise

Like Rotten Tomatoes aggregates movie reviews, physicians can curate expert opinions or patient experiences related to specific treatments or conditions. This strategy can be particularly effective for topics where your own direct experience is limited. By presenting a well-rounded view that includes multiple perspectives, you can build a content-rich page that increases credibility and attracts more visitors.

5. Internal Linking with a Reverse Silo Approach

Most physicians produce various forms of content, from blog posts about health tips to detailed treatment explanations. By strategically using internal linking, you can direct visitors from general information pages to more specific content or from high-traffic pages to key conversion pages. This method distributes page authority across your site, lifting the SEO performance of individual pages.

6. Leverage Unique Data and Case Studies

As a physician, you have access to unique clinical data and case studies which can be turned into compelling content. Some surgeons I’ve worked with have even gone as far as posting their outcomes data on an annual basis.

7. Regularly Update Your Content

The medical field is constantly evolving, and keeping your content up-to-date is crucial. Regular updates signal to search engines that your site is a current and reliable resource. This could involve revising statistics, adding new findings from recent studies, or updating your articles to reflect new health guidelines.


Implementing these SEO strategies will help physicians not only improve their website’s search engine rankings but also enhance their online authority and trustworthiness. By focusing on high-quality, experienced-based content and optimizing site structure, physicians can effectively reach and engage their target audience.

Scroll to Top
Doctor working with an SEO team to attract new patients

Want to rank higher on Google?

Get FREE exclusive SEO insights for Doctors directly into your inbox.

  • This field is for validation purposes and should be left unchanged.